Summary

I am a polymer engineer with over 10 years of experience in polymer engineering, holding a PhD from the Iran Polymer and Petrochemical Institute (IPPI). My expertise includes polymerization and polymer characterization. I have worked on research projects related to the production of commercial polymers and have served as a reviewer for two Iranian polymer journals. My research integrates advanced techniques such as NMR, GPC, and viscometry with density functional theory (DFT) studies. I am eager to further my expertise through the PhD program at Hasselt University and contribute to innovative research in polymer quantum mechanics.

PhD Research

Iran Polymer and Petrochemical Institute (IPPI)
01.2016 - 01.2021
  • Investigated the synthesis of polyalphaolefin (PAO) oils using AlCl3 catalysts
  • Analyzed oligomers using NMR, GPC, and viscometry
  • Conducted DFT studies to predict polymer behavior.
